Understanding Conversion: What it Means for Web Design in Wellfleet MA
Conversion Defined for Small Businesses in Wellfleet MA
Conversion is one of the most important—but most misunderstood—ideas in web design for local businesses. In simple terms, a conversion happens when a visitor to your website takes a specific action you want, like making a purchase, calling your business, booking a service, or filling out a contact form. For Wellfleet’s small businesses, this could mean a customer reserving a table at your café, scheduling an appointment at your clinic, or signing up for local services. The path from landing page to conversion needs to be short, logical, and clearly marked at every step.
Effective design and development focus on guiding visitors through the website with as little friction as possible. If the call to action isn’t clear or the path to booking is hidden in menus, the chance of conversion drops dramatically. Across Cape Cod and Southeastern Massachusetts, businesses that consistently keep their conversion goals front and center on their sites see stronger results. This means simple, scannable layouts, obvious buttons, and minimal distractions—qualities that professional web design companies and design agencies in Wellfleet, Plymouth, and beyond prioritize in their custom web projects for local businesses.

Scrolling vs. Clicking: Natural Website Habits across Southeastern Massachusetts
Scrolling is now the default way people explore websites—especially on mobile devices. Customers from Wellfleet to Middleborough and Raynham expect to find core information by simply scrolling down a page, not by clicking through deep menus or extra landing pages. A well-structured custom web design prioritizes this behavior by making content easy to scan, with sections broken into logical blocks and calls-to-action placed regularly throughout. The best web design agencies pay close attention to these user flow trends to keep visitors engaged from the homepage to the final action.
Clicking, on the other hand, interrupts the experience. For local businesses, requiring more than a few clicks to reach essential details—such as your services, location, or contact method—results in lost interest. This is especially true when customers are comparing several options, as is common across the towns of Wareham, Kingston, and even as far as Rhode Island. Limiting the number of clicks not only provides a smoother user experience, but also increases conversion rates by keeping customers moving toward action without confusion.

Common Web Design and Development Mistakes That Cost Local Businesses Customers
Several frequent mistakes can undermine the effectiveness of web design in Wellfleet, leading to lost business opportunities despite offering great products or services. One common mistake is confusing navigation; if visitors do not instantly see where to click or scroll, frustration builds. Slow-loading pages—especially on mobile—also prompt users to abandon the site, as do layouts that are cluttered or disorganized.
Other pitfalls include missing or outdated local contact details, making it hard for customers to find or reach you, and content that’s dense or hard to scan. What’s the difference between web design and web development?
Web design is about the look, style, and user experience of your website—what visitors see and interact with. Web development focuses on the technical aspects: how your site is built, works, and performs behind the scenes.
